Abstract

Nrf2, a key cellular regulator, plays a complex and multifaceted role in both protecting healthy cells and potentially promoting disease progression. This chapter delves into the intricate mechanisms by which Nrf2 exerts its protective effects, including combating carcinogens, maintaining cellular integrity, and inducing controlled cell death under severe stress. However, the chapter also explores the “dark side” of Nrf2, where its activity in cancer cells can contribute to chemoresistance, adaptation, and growth, hindering effective treatment. The chapter further investigates current research avenues for harnessing Nrf2’s potential for therapeutic benefit. Strategies for both activation and inhibition are explored, highlighting the importance of context-dependent effects, balancing protection and potential harm, and minimizing off-target effects. Promising new directions, such as developing tissue-specific modulators, identifying predictive biomarkers, and combining Nrf2 modulators with other therapeutic approaches, are also discussed. By understanding Nrf2’s complex and context-dependent roles, we can pave the way for the development of safer and more effective therapeutic strategies that leverage its beneficial effects while mitigating its potential drawbacks in various diseases.
